My argument for WoTA supports the theory that, as an AP Caster, Orianna should not be on the front lines and should only 1v1 someone if she absolutely knows she can destroy them in one to two combos. In a team fight however there should always be someone in front of her. However, in your defense, when she has to get closer and attack, using a proc'd hit in my build or stacking up Clockwork Windup stats in yours, you can get taken out of a fight fairly quickly because you have to recall due to not having any sustain. Most of the time with WoTA you can stay in for a much longer amount of time because of the immense damage you are doing to the other team... not minions, which is good since you can devastate the other team by simply not going away. The extra 30 AP to the rest of your team can also help out quite a bit if you have another caster or hybrid build on your team.
Also, I disagree with you saying that she has to be using her clockwork windup to fully utilize her. Yes it is very useful... early to mid game and extremely late game... kinda, but just like any caster she should be in the back, constantly moving the ball around and raping face. If you have to go in and Auto Attack in order to get a kill then go for it. In fact, had the above game lasted another minute or so I was going to be buying a lichbane and I would have been sounding off 1100+ HP Auto attacks every 2 seconds. It would also be a big deal if you were doing an on hit build because then it would be even more useful, but it is not one of her defining/game changing features by itself.
No one build is perfect for any champ every time *notice the Boots of mobility I used in the above game*, but if you want clockwork windup to be a selling point then a full AP build isn't the way to go unless you throw a Lichbane in there as well so that you can show that she then does(91 Auto Attack + 730AP Lichbane Proc + (30 Clockwork windup Base + 146 based off of AP + 173 based off of 30% increase at 3 stacks) = (821 Attack Damage) + (349 Magic Damage) = 1170 TOTAL POSSIBLE DAMAGE in a single Auto Attack on an enemy champion. Please note however that Clockwork Windup does not proc on or build stacks off of turrets. Lichbane does however, so you can still go in and poke once every two seconds for 821 damage on a turret for a good quick final push...
